What is a .JPEG file?

.JPEG file belongs to the category of Raster Image Files used in operating systems such as Windows 11, 10, Windows 7, Windows 8 / 8.1, Windows Vista, Windows XP.

.JPEG file is associated with JPEG Image developed by Joint Photographic Experts Group, has a Binary Format and belongs to Raster Image Files category.

A JPEG File is a popular image file format. This type of file is saved with the method of lossy compression. In other words, it is saved in a compressed graphic format. The main disadvantage is that the image quality may be noticeably reduced. But the compression level can be adjusted, as a consequence, you can reach a better image quality. Users commonly save digital photos and web graphics as JPEG files.

Additional information

JPEG image file format was standardized by the Joint Photographic Experts Group. The format has been the choice for storing and transmitting photographic images on the web.

Nowadays, there are a lot of Operating systems, that support visualization of JPEG images. Moreover, it is supported by web browsers as well.
